Transaction 73a62a027ee779364f2c55a89832ca4c93008897b69533ebd8c4c5f251a389ec
1 Input
1 Output
-
73a62a027ee779364f2c55a89832ca4c93008897b69533ebd8c4c5f251a389ec:0
- value
- 26938
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0cd1d7acce4ae86da5b3038ee1b7b94c73566b9f OP_EQUAL
- address
- 32roQxTBMheg8R1S95442sCRp4Eq8cC35N